          Well done Wiener Philharmoniker.
          Very enjoyable.
          What a nice gesture of Barenboim btw to shake hands with the orchestra (and to give today's earnings to charities)
          Great choreography especially in Delibes' Pizzicati Polka , and great pictures illustrating G'schichten aus dem Wienerwald, too. And that Dynamiden-walzer definitely is music which Richard Strauss thought good enough to re-use again (like Bruch and his own Capriccio Mondscheinmusik).

          Nevertheless enough of the Strauss family for the rest of the year for me, I'm afraid.
